razor

Razor ist eine Vorlagensprache, die von ASP.NET-Webseiten und ASP.NET MVC (seit Version 3) verwendet wird. Es fügt eine Abstraktionsebene oberhalb der HTML-Generierung hinzu. Es unterstützt nahtlose Übergänge zwischen HTML Markup und C # oder VB Code. Übergänge zwischen Markup und Code werden durch das "@" Zeichen angezeigt.
2
Antworten

Was sind die Best Practices für Asp.net MVC Seitenaufbau, um Parallelität und Effizienz zu ermöglichen?

Ich fand es schwierig, mit irgendetwas in dieser Kritik von ASP.net MVCs Framework für die Seitenzusammensetzung zu argumentieren. Ссылка Besonders diese Punkte: Kein Zugriff auf View- oder Partial View-Instanzen ViewData ist Ihr l...
21.12.2011, 23:37
2
Antworten

ASP.NET MVC 4 / Web API - Fügen Sie den Razor Renderer für Accepts: text / html ein

Ich erstelle einen RESTful Web Service mit der ASP.NET MVC 4 Web API. Für den API-Zugriff gebe ich JSON zurück, obwohl, sobald alles korrekt funktioniert, die Inhaltsverhandlung für XML und JSON standardmäßig funktionieren sollte. Da ich an e...
02.08.2012, 17:54
1
Antwort

Die Formatierung des Razor-Editors funktioniert nach der Installation von Web Essentials und Web Compiler nicht

Ich habe gerade meinen Computer mit einer Neuinstallation von Visual Studio 2015 neu aufgebaut. Ich habe auch die Erweiterungen für Web Essentials und Web Compiler installiert, aber diese scheinen ein Problem verursacht zu haben. Sagen Sie zu...
04.09.2015, 07:48
2
Antworten

Liste der ASP.Net MVC "speziellen" Ordner / Dateien

Gibt es eine Liste der "speziellen" Ordner und Dateien in ASP.Net MVC? Ich spreche über Dinge wie "Views / Shared / EditorTemplates" und "Views / _ViewStart.cshtml." BEARBEITEN: Als Reaktion auf den CodeIgnoto-Kommentar frage ich nicht nach...
06.05.2013, 12:55
2
Antworten

Razor: benutzerdefiniertes BeginForm () - wie Razor Einweg-Block funktioniert in einigen Fällen nicht

Ich habe eine benutzerdefinierte Implementierung eines Blocks, der ähnlich wie Html.BeginForm() funktioniert. Die Implementierung ist im Wesentlichen wie folgt: %Vor% Dann kann ich meiner Meinung nach tun: %Vor% Um zu bekommen: %Vor...
02.01.2013, 22:01
1
Antwort

ASP.NET MVC3 Bindung an Unterklasse

Ich habe eine Oberklasse vom Typ Question mit mehreren Unterklassen (z. B. MultipleChoiceQuestion und TextQuestion ). Jede der Unterklassen hat ihre eigenen Editor-Vorlagen (z. B. ~ / Shared / EditorTemplates / MultipleChoiceQuestion.cshtm...
20.07.2011, 12:49
1
Antwort

Visual Studio 2017 cshtml Syntax Hervorhebung funktioniert nicht

Ich benutze VS 2015 seit geraumer Zeit und bin erst kürzlich nach 2017 gezogen. Mein cshtml Text ist alle eine Farbe (schwarz) und ich habe versucht herauszufinden, warum sie nicht wie meine anderen Dateitypen hervorheben. Irgendwelche Ideen? Da...
19.05.2017, 13:27
1
Antwort

Kompilieren von Razor Ansichten in eine einzelne Assembly

Was ist der am wenigsten invasive Weg, .cshtml views in eine einzelne Assembly zu kompilieren? Mit "am wenigsten invasiv" meine ich etwas, das nicht mit benutzerdefiniertem Werkzeug herumgewirbelt werden muss, esoterische Werte in .cshtml...
21.06.2013, 13:18
1
Antwort

Wie können MVC3-Controller / Ansichten in mehreren Apps am besten wiederverwendet werden?

Ich überschreibe einige alte ASP-Anwendungen, die nicht gut strukturiert waren, und versuche dabei .NET und MVC3 zu lernen. Es gibt zwei Hauptanwendungen, von denen eine den Code von der anderen wiederverwendet und in Wirklichkeit nur eine sehr...
31.10.2011, 20:39
1
Antwort

Testen Sie die Funktion "System.Web.Mvc.ViewEngines.Engines.FindPartialView"

Ich möchte die Funktion System.Web.Mvc.ViewEngines.Engines.FindPartialView (Einheit) testen und die korrekte Rückgabe des HTML-Codes überprüfen. Aber jedes Mal, wenn ich den Komponententest starte, wird eine "Object reference not set to a...
10.11.2011, 12:27